Principal Secretary visits G&B, ST hostels at Samba, Kathua; assess functioning
FacebookTwitterWhatsappTelegram

Reviews progress on construction of newly sanctioned tribal hostels in twin districts

JAMMU, MARCH 10: Principal Secretary, Tribal Affairs, Suresh Kumar Gupta, today visited Gujjar and Bakarwal (G&B) and Schedule Tribe (ST) hostels of Samba and Kathua to assess functioning of existing tribal hostels, besides reviewing progress on construction of newly sanctioned tribal hostels in the twin districts.

At G&B/ST hostel Samba, the Principal Secretary interacted with the hostel students and enquired them about the facilities being extended to them there. He gave some valuable tips to the students going to appear in the board examinations extending them best wishes. He also inspected hostel rooms, kitchen, dining hall besides conducting a round of hostel premises.

Deputy Commissioner Samba, Abhishek Sharma, Director Tribal Affairs, Musheer Ahmed Mirza, Director Libraries, Mohammad Rafi, Secretary J&K Academy of Art, Culture and Languages, Bharat Singh Manhas, hostel staff and others were present on the occasion.

The Director Tribal Affairs briefed the Principal Secretary about the welfare and developmental schemes being implemented by the Tribal Affairs Department besides apprising him of working of the hostel, facilities being provided to the students in these tribal hostels. He also informed about the modernization plan for the hostels. He further informed that the hostel students had rare opportunity to witness Republic Day Parade celebrations January 2024 at New Delhi with the help of Union Ministry of Tribal Affairs, where students met the Prime Minister, Union Tribal Minister and other dignitaries besides visiting heritage sites in and around Delhi.

The Deputy Commissioner Samba briefed the Principal Secretary, about the support being provided by the district administration to the hostel inmates. He informed that Rs. 7.00 lakh have been sanctioned by the district administration for developing playground in the hostel saying that the work on the same shall be completed before the end of current financial year 2024.

Regarding construction of Girls Hostel near AIIMS Samba, it was informed that funds have been released and placed at the disposal of the district administration Samba.

The Principal Secretary directed the executing agencies to start the construction work as early as possible so that tribal girls students may utilize the facility to continue their studies.

At Kathua, the Principal Secretary inspected G&B/ST Boys hostel besides reviewing status of sanctioned girls hostel for the district. He directed the executing agency to submit detailed project report immediately for further necessary action as the department has already released funds for construction of the hostel, and the work has not been started yet.

The Director Tribal Affairs further informed the Principal Secretary with regard to status of Banni hostel besides Pre and Post-Matric Scholarships being provided to the tribal students in Kathua district.

The Principal Secretary assured that every possible help shall be extended to the hostel students in the field of education and sports so that they can excel in their life for a brighter future.
